Seven telecom companies in HCM City that supplied illegal cable TV and Internet services have been fined VND 35 million ($2,060) each. Their equipment was also seized.

Five companies were fined for setting up cable TV and Internet networks without licenses, namely the Blue Sky Telecom Company, the Life Broadband Information JS Company, the Dai Phuc Media JS Company, the New Urban Media Co, Ltd., and the Viet Thanh Technology Co, Ltd.

Two other companies, the Phu My TV Cable JS Company and Song Thu Co, Ltd., were fined for owning a cable TV network without a license.

These companies cooperated with the HCM City Television Station (HTV) to develop TV infrastructure facilities but they did not ask for a license from the authorities.

In late 2008, the Ministry of Information and Communications imposed a VND 35 million fine on two firms, Somonet and Elinco, for similar reason.

So far, there are only ten companies licensed by the Ministry to build telecom networks and provide telecom services in Vietnam.
